Key Insights of Japan Child Breathing Filter Market
- Market size estimated at approximately $150 million in 2023, with rapid growth driven by rising health consciousness.
- Projected compound annual growth rate (CAGR) of 12.5% from 2026 to 2033, reflecting increasing adoption of advanced respiratory protection devices for children.
- Major segments include disposable filters, reusable masks, and integrated respiratory devices, with disposable filters leading due to convenience and hygiene.
- Core applications span urban pollution mitigation, infectious disease prevention, and allergy management, with urban centers like Tokyo and Osaka dominating demand.
- Key geographic share resides with Japan’s metropolitan regions, accounting for over 70% of total market volume, driven by dense populations and pollution levels.

Japan Child Breathing Filter Market Regulatory & Policy Environment
The regulatory landscape in Japan is characterized by rigorous standards for medical devices and consumer health products, with agencies like PMDA (Pharmaceuticals and Medical Devices Agency) overseeing compliance. Recent policies emphasize air quality improvement, infection control, and pediatric health, creating a conducive environment for innovation and market entry. Manufacturers must adhere to strict safety, efficacy, and labeling requirements, which can serve as barriers but also as quality signals to consumers.
Government initiatives, such as subsidies for pollution mitigation and public health campaigns, bolster market growth. The Japan Ministry of Environment actively promotes eco-friendly product standards, encouraging sustainable manufacturing practices. Emerging Technologies & Innovation in Japan Child Breathing Filters
Technological advancements are transforming the landscape of child respiratory protection in Japan. Innovations include nanofiber filtration, which offers high efficiency with minimal breath resistance, and antimicrobial coatings to inhibit pathogen growth. Smart filters embedded with sensors can monitor air quality and provide real-time feedback via mobile apps, enhancing user engagement and safety.
Development of biodegradable filters addresses environmental concerns, aligning with Japan’s sustainability commitments.
